About the Business

Lexis Nexis® Risk Solutions provides customers with solutions and decision tools that combine public and industry specific content with advanced technology and analytics to assist them in evaluating and predicting risk and enhancing operational efficiency. We use the power of data and advanced analytics to help our customers make better, timelier decisions. By bringing clarity to information, we ultimately help make communities safer, insurance rates more accurate, commerce more transparent, business decisions easier and processes more efficient.

About the Role

The Director, Employee & Leadership Communications and Employer Brand is responsible for the strategy, creation and delivery of employee and leadership communications that connect employees to the company's culture, values, business priorities and employee experience.

Leading a multidisciplinary team spanning internal communications, executive communications, town halls, newsletters, digital employee experiences and creative design, this role develops the stories, content and engagement opportunities that shape how employees experience the organization.

Responsibilities
  • Lead all employee and leadership communications, including executive messaging, organizational announcements, leadership updates and employee engagement campaigns.
  • Develop and execute an integrated content and storytelling strategy that connects employees to company priorities, culture, values and employee experiences.
  • Oversee enterprise town halls, leadership forums and employee communication events, ensuring a consistent and engaging employee experience.
  • Own strategy and oversight for employee newsletters, communication campaigns and editorial planning across internal channels.
  • Lead SharePoint and digital employee experience content strategy, design and user experience to improve communication effectiveness and employee engagement.
  • Oversee graphic design and creative services, ensuring communications and campaigns are visually compelling, brand-aligned and audience focused.
  • Develop engaging campaigns and experiences that support culture, belonging, recognition, volunteering, learning, wellbeing and other employee-focused initiatives.
  • Partner with executives and senior leaders to identify opportunities for leadership visibility, storytelling and employee connection.
